Solution for What is 5560 increased by 64 percent? (5560 plus 64%):

5560 + (64/100 * 5560) = 9118.4

Now we have: 5560 increased by 64 percent = 9118.4

Question: What is 5560 increased by 64 percent?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We have a with value of 5560.

Step 2: We have b with value of 64.

Step 3: The formula for calculation will be: a + (b/100 * a) = x.

Step 4: We could also represent this as: x = a + (\frac{b}{100} * a).

Step 5: We now replace with the values: x = 5560 + (\frac{64}{100} * 5560).

Step 6: That gives us an {x} = {9118.4}

Therefore, {5560} increased by {64\%} is {9118.4}
